- #TERMINAL TEXT EDITOR MAC OS#
- #TERMINAL TEXT EDITOR INSTALL#
- #TERMINAL TEXT EDITOR UPDATE#
- #TERMINAL TEXT EDITOR WINDOWS#
This environment variable overrides $EDITOR and $VISUAL. In my case, that's nano (which I assume is default for Ubuntu, because I don't remember consciously making an effort to change my default editor).īut on other systems other than Ubuntu (or I should say which have no Debian's alternatives system), there is no editor. Here's mine (private info is unset of course): $ git var -lĪs heemayl already pointed out, editor command is the one set by /etc/alternatives/editor. Select current word at first press.There is actually git var -l which allows you to list the variables, including GIT_EDITOR variable. Select text to end of mark to select text region. Run make to compile source files and captureĮrror messages. Insert lines of text without auto indentation.Įxecute external shell command and insert the Insert line comment character at top of lines inĭelete line comment character at top of lines in Following items are typical in programming languages. Show difference between original file and currentĬonvert selected text to Unicode NormalizationĬonvert alphabet and numbers in the selected textĬode menu differs among file types. The menu item is executed by typing the underlined key with or without pressing alt key. Each items in the menu has one underlined character. To display menu, type F1 key or alt+m (type ‘m’ key with alt key). Functional keys like arrow or delete keys also works.
#TERMINAL TEXT EDITOR UPDATE#
Typing alphabet keys will update file as you expected. Spefify kaa command id to execute at start-up e.g: kaa -x nsole / kaa -x ep Usage Specify terminal type -command command, -x command Skip loading initialization script -init-script INIT_SCRIPTĮxecute file as initialization script instead of default initialization file -palette PALETTEĬolor palette. e.g., If you use bash, add following line to ~/.bashrc file: $ export TERM =xterm-256colorįor detail, see to enable 256 color on your terminal. Otherwise, you should manually update terminal setting. Select xterm-256color for “Report terminal type” field. Select xterm-256color for “Declare terminal as” field.įor iTerm2, you can set 256 color mode with following procedure:
#TERMINAL TEXT EDITOR MAC OS#
For Terminal.app on Mac OS X, you can set 256 color mode with following procedure: Kaa looks better with 256 color mode of terminal emulator. Scroll to the Help/Contents shortcut and change key from F1 to some another key. If you use Gnome terminal and wishes to access menu by F1 key, you should configure: Or, if you use iTerm2 on Mac, you should configure:Ĭheck Left option Key acts as: +Esc. But on Mac OS X, Terminal app should be configured:
#TERMINAL TEXT EDITOR WINDOWS#
On most of recent Windows or Linux terminal, alt key works out of box. Kaa uses alt key for keyboard shortcut like alt+k.
#TERMINAL TEXT EDITOR INSTALL#
Use easy_install3 or pip3 to install kaa from PyPI $ sudo easy_install3 -U kaaedit Terminal setting Keyboard setting For Ubuntu Linux, following command installs xclip command. To use clipboard on Unix platform, xclip command should be installed. For recent Debian/Ubuntu, you can install required libraries by $ sudo apt-get install libncursesw5 libncurses5-dev libncursesw5-devĪfter theses packages are installed, rebuild Python installation to take effect. Consult documentation of your platform for details. If your Python installation is not system-supplied package but built by yourself, please ensure you have installed ncurses library with wide character support before you built Python. For recent Debian/Ubuntu, you can install required libraries by $ sudo apt-get install python3-dev To run kaa, you need following component:ĭevelopment files for Python 3.3.
Kaa requires Unicode friendly environment both platform running kaa and terminal emulator/console to interact with kaa.Ĭygwin environment on Windows platform is not supported at this time, but will be tested after they provide Python 3.3 package. Kaa is a CUI editor that runs on most of modern UN*X flavor operating systems like Linux or Mac OS X. So, you can easily customize many aspects of kaa through simple Python scripts. You can use kaa as easy as you are with Notepad on MS-Windows.
Most of basic features could be accessed from fancy menus by hitting underlined character in the menu items. Only thing you need to remember is “To display menu, hit F1 key or alt+’m’ key”. Kaa is very easy to learn in spite of its rich functionality. Kaa is an easy yet powerful text editor for console user interface, providing numerous features like Kaa is a small and easy CUI text editor for console/terminal emulator environments.